Output 3681298a18b786c4ae2a17ac3acd826380c36812a2d84322dbddfd030715ea42:1

value
6504065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a732760ebd6a784cbd051630f25b83afa2dad91b OP_EQUAL
address
3Gw5DgY4fW5oHzZEcAx1NiSCbW3kfzRoJu
transaction
3681298a18b786c4ae2a17ac3acd826380c36812a2d84322dbddfd030715ea42
confirmations
360142
spent
true